 /* главное меню*/

.menu-generall		  	 { font-size: 12px; color: #000000; font-family: Verdana; text-align:center; text-decoration:none; background-image:url('images/sep.gif'); font-weight:bold}
.menu-generall a 	  	{ display: block; color: #000000; text-decoration: none}
.menu-generall a:hover 	{ font-family: Verdana; font-size: 12px; color: #ffffff; text-decoration: underline; 
						  background-image:url('images/sep-1.gif'); padding-top:7px; padding-bottom:8px; background-position-y:center}
 /* основная таблица */
.txt-table	  		{ font-family: Verdana; font-size: 10pt; color: #647676; text-align:left; text-decoration: none}

/* меню левой колонки мелкое*/
.menu-left		  	{ font-family: Verdana; font-size: 8pt; color: #000000;  text-align:left; text-decoration:none; padding-top:2px; padding-bottom:2px; background-color:#E8E8E8 }
.menu-left a 	  	{ display: block; font-family: Verdana; font-size: 8pt; color: #000000; text-decoration: none; padding-top:2px; padding-bottom:2px;  }
.menu-left a:hover 	{ font-size: 8pt; color: #000000; color: #FFFFFF; text-decoration: underline; padding-top:2px; padding-bottom:2px; background-image:url('images/sep-1.gif') }

/* меню левой колонки мелкое*/
.menu-left-icq	  	{ font-family: Verdana; font-size: 8pt; color: #000000;  text-align:left; text-decoration:none; padding-top:2px; padding-bottom:2px; background-color:#E8E8E8 }


/* гиперссылки красные в тексте */
.h1           		{ font-family: Verdana; font-size: 10pt; text-decoration: none; color:#ff0000}

/* меню левой колонки большое*/
.ss-lka		  		{ font-family: Verdana; font-size: 8pt; color: #000000;  text-align:center; text-decoration:none;  }
.ss-lka a 	  		{ display: block; font-family: Verdana; font-size: 8pt; color: #000000; text-decoration: none  }
.ss-lka a:hover 	{ font-family: Verdana; font-size: 8pt; color: #000000; color: #FFFFFF; text-decoration:none; background-color:#003399 }


/* меню левой колонки большое*/
.table-v		  	{ font-family: Verdana; font-size: 10pt; color: #000000;  text-align:center; text-decoration:none; padding-top:2px; padding-bottom:2px; background-color:#C0C0C0; font-weight:bold }
.table-v a 	  		{ display: block; font-family: Verdana; font-size: 8pt; color: #000000; text-decoration: none; padding-top:2px; padding-bottom:2px;  }
.table-v a:hover 	{ font-size: 8pt; color: #000000; color: #FFFFFF; text-decoration: underline; padding-top:2px; padding-bottom:2px; background-image:url('images/sep-1.gif') }

/* меню левой колонки не активное */
.menu-left-no		  	{ font-family: Verdana; font-size: 8pt; color: #FFFFFF;  text-align:left; text-decoration:none; padding-top:2px; padding-bottom:2px; background-image:url('images/sep-1.gif') }

/* основные заголовки в центре*/
.mainest-head        { background-p: 0% 0%; width: 100%;  height: 31px;  padding-left:3px; padding-right:0px; padding-top:5px; padding-bottom:0px; background-image:url('images/heady.gif'); background-repeat:repeat-x; background-attachment:scroll; font-family:Verdana; color:#666666; font-size:10pt; font-weight:bold; text-align:center}

/* подзаголовки в центре*/
.mainest 			{ height: 31px;  padding-left:3px; font-family:Verdana; color:#666666; font-size:10pt; font-weight:bold; text-align:center; background-color:#E9E9E9; text-decoration:none; background-image:url('images/heady1.gif')}
.mainest a 			{ height: 31px;  padding-left:3px; font-family:Verdana; color:#666666; font-size:10pt; font-weight:bold; text-align:center; background-color:#E9E9E9; text-decoration:none}
.mainest a:hover	{ height: 31px;  padding-left:3px; font-family:Verdana; color:#666666; font-size:10pt; font-weight:bold; text-align:center; background-color:#E9E9E9; text-decoration:none underline}


/* заголовки вверху листа активные */
.txt-prim	  		{ font-family: Tahoma; font-size: 8pt; font-weight:bold; text-align:left; color:#003399; text-decoration:none }
.txt-prim	a  		{ font-family: Tahoma; font-size: 8pt; font-weight:bold; text-align:left; color:#003399; text-decoration:none }
.txt-prim	a:hover	{ font-family: Tahoma; font-size: 8pt; font-weight:bold; text-align:left; color:#003399; text-decoration:none }


/* примечания внизу страницы */
.txt-prim-niz	  { font-family: Tahoma; font-size: 8pt; color:#FFFFFF; text-align:center }

/* ссылка на почту*/
.amenu-txt	  		{ font-family: Verdana; font-size: 8pt; color: #ffffff;  text-decoration:none; }
.amenu-txt a	  	{ display: block; font-family: Verdana; font-size: 8pt; color: #ffffff; text-decoration: none; }
.amenu-txt a:hover	{ font-family: Verdana; font-size: 8pt; color: #ffffff; text-decoration: underline; }

/* телефон внизу */
.tlf {font-family: Verdana; font-size: 24pt; color: #FFFFFF; text-align: center}

/* красные выделения в тексте */
.txtred {font-family: Verdana; font-size: 8pt; color: #FF0000; text-align: center; font-weight:bold}

.c-left-n { width: 55%; vertical-align: top; color: #647676; line-height: 20px;}
.c-right-o { width: 45%;  vertical-align: top;}

/* красная ссылка в тексте */
.h1           {  font-family: Verdana; font-size: 10pt; text-decoration: none; color:#ff0000}